To amend section 2907.03 of the Revised Code to | 1 |
expand the offense of "sexual battery" to prohibit | 2 |
a peace officer from engaging in sexual conduct | 3 |
with a minor who is not the officer's spouse. | 4 |
Section 1. That section 2907.03 of the Revised Code be | 5 |
amended to read as follows: | 6 |
Sec. 2907.03. (A) No person shall engage in sexual conduct | 7 |
with another, not the spouse of the offender, when any of the | 8 |
following apply: | 9 |
(1) The offender knowingly coerces the other person to submit | 10 |
by any means that would prevent resistance by a person of ordinary | 11 |
resolution. | 12 |
(2) The offender knows that the other person's ability to | 13 |
appraise the nature of or control the other person's own conduct | 14 |
is substantially impaired. | 15 |
(3) The offender knows that the other person submits because | 16 |
the other person is unaware that the act is being committed. | 17 |
(4) The offender knows that the other person submits because | 18 |
the other person mistakenly identifies the offender as the other | 19 |
person's spouse. | 20 |
(5) The offender is the other person's natural or adoptive | 21 |
parent, or a stepparent, or guardian, custodian, or person in loco | 22 |
parentis of the other person. | 23 |
(6) The other person is in custody of law or a patient in a | 24 |
hospital or other institution, and the offender has supervisory or | 25 |
disciplinary authority over the other person. | 26 |
(7) The offender is a teacher, administrator, coach, or other | 27 |
person in authority employed by or serving in a school for which | 28 |
the state board of education prescribes minimum standards pursuant | 29 |
to division (D) of section 3301.07 of the Revised Code, the other | 30 |
person is enrolled in or attends that school, and the offender is | 31 |
not enrolled in and does not attend that school. | 32 |
(8) The other person is a minor, the offender is a teacher, | 33 |
administrator, coach, or other person in authority employed by or | 34 |
serving in an institution of higher education, and the other | 35 |
person is enrolled in or attends that institution. | 36 |
(9) The other person is a minor, and the offender is the | 37 |
other person's athletic or other type of coach, is the other | 38 |
person's instructor, is the leader of a scouting troop of which | 39 |
the other person is a member, or is a person with temporary or | 40 |
occasional disciplinary control over the other person. | 41 |
(10) The offender is a mental health professional, the other | 42 |
person is a mental health client or patient of the offender, and | 43 |
the offender induces the other person to submit by falsely | 44 |
representing to the other person that the sexual conduct is | 45 |
necessary for mental health treatment purposes. | 46 |
(11) The other person is confined in a detention facility, | 47 |
and the offender is an employee of that detention facility. | 48 |
(12) The other person is a minor, the offender is a cleric, | 49 |
and the other person is a member of, or attends, the church or | 50 |
congregation served by the cleric. | 51 |
(13) The other person is a minor, and the offender is a peace | 52 |
officer. | 53 |
(B) Whoever violates this section is guilty of sexual | 54 |
battery. Except as otherwise provided in this division, sexual | 55 |
battery is a felony of the third degree. If the other person is | 56 |
less than thirteen years of age, sexual battery is a felony of the | 57 |
second degree, and the court shall impose upon the offender a | 58 |
mandatory prison term equal to one of the prison terms prescribed | 59 |
in section 2929.14 of the Revised Code for a felony of the second | 60 |
degree. | 61 |
(C) As used in this section: | 62 |
(1) "Cleric" has the same meaning as in section 2317.02 of | 63 |
the Revised Code. | 64 |
(2) "Detention facility" has the same meaning as in section | 65 |
2921.01 of the Revised Code. | 66 |
(3) "Institution of higher education" means a state | 67 |
institution of higher education defined in section 3345.011 of the | 68 |
Revised Code, a private nonprofit college or university located in | 69 |
this state that possesses a certificate of authorization issued by | 70 |
the Ohio board of regents pursuant to Chapter 1713. of the Revised | 71 |
Code, or a school certified under Chapter 3332. of the Revised | 72 |
Code. | 73 |
(4) "Peace officer" has the same meaning as in section | 74 |
2935.01 of the Revised Code. | 75 |
Section 2. That existing section 2907.03 of the Revised Code | 76 |
is hereby repealed. | 77 |
Section 3. Section 2907.03 of the Revised Code is presented | 78 |
in this act as a composite of the section as amended by both Am. | 79 |
Sub. H.B. 95 and Am. Sub. S.B. 17 of the 126th General Assembly. | 80 |
The General Assembly, applying the principle stated in division | 81 |
(B) of section 1.52 of the Revised Code that amendments are to be | 82 |
harmonized if reasonably capable of simultaneous operation, finds | 83 |
that the composite is the resulting version of the section in | 84 |
effect prior to the effective date of the section as presented in | 85 |
this act. | 86 |
